STAGE TUBE: Anne Hathaway Sings on THE SIMPSONS
by BroadwayWorld TV - January 11, 2010
Stage and film actress Anne Hathaway made an appearance in Springfield as Princess Penelope, a new sidekick to Krusty the Clown, on Fox’s 'The Simpsons'. In the episode, titled 'Once Upon a Time in Springfield', Hathaway sings "A Princess Knows,' 'Glitter and Sparkle' and 'Watered with Love'; she also sings a brief part of Henry Mancini and Johnny Mercer’s classic 'Moon River.' Photo Flash: 'tick, tick...BOOM!' At Westport Country Playhouse
by BWW News Desk - June 25, 2009
From the genius who created the smash hit, "Rent," comes "tick, tick...BOOM!," a vital American musical about a young artist on the verge in New York City. Westport Country Playhouse, Westport, Connecticut, will stage this lesser-known work by Jonathan Larson, June 23 through July 18. The director is Scott Schwartz, who helmed the original off-Broadway production of "tick, tick... BOOM!," winner of the Outer Critics Circle Award for outstanding musical. (more...)

'ROOMS A Rock Romance' Opens 3/16
by BWW News Desk - March 15, 2009
Van Hill Entertainment and Red Griffin Media present the Off-Broadway premiere of ROOMS a rock romance, starring Leslie Kritzer and Doug Kreeger. Performances began Friday, February 27th at New World Stages/Stage 2 (340 West 50th Street). Opening Night is set for Monday March 16th.
ROOMS a rock romance has music and lyrics by Paul Scott Goodman with a book by Goodman and Miriam Gordon, and is directed by Scott Schwartz (Golda's Balcony, Bat Boy: The Musical, tick, tick... BOOM!, Jane Eyre). (more...)
